Guide to fix Kindle unable to connect to Wi-Fi


Restart your device

The first and foremost thing you should do to fix the Kindle issue is to restart your Kindle device. To restart the Kindle, you can simply press and hold the power button for a few seconds and then leave it. Turn on the device again, and try connecting it to the Wi-Fi network. If the solution does not work, proceed with the next troubleshooting steps.


Reset the router

If the restart is not fixing your concern, you must move ahead and reset your router. There are chances that something is wrong with your router itself, not the device, so a simple reset can help you to make sure that everything is in the right place. To reset, you can simply refer to the router manual and find the simple instructions. After the reset, you can connect your Kindle device to the Wi-Fi using the default login information.


Update the Kindle

The outdated version of the Kindle e-reader could also be the reason that you are unable to connect it to the Wi-Fi. If you want to fix this problem, you must upgrade your Kindle device to the latest version available.


Place your Kindle nearby the router

The far distance between your Kindle and router may also raise connectivity concerns. So you can try placing your Kindle device at a shorter distance from the router and try to connect again.  If you see the network name appearing in the list, tap on it, and enter the password to get connected.
